  2. Seth Woodbury MacFarlane (⫽ m ə k ˈ f ɑːr l ɪ n ⫽; born October 26, 1973) is an American actor, animator, writer, producer, director, comedian, and singer. MacFarlane is well known as the creator and star of the television series Family Guy (since 1999) and The Orville (2017–2022), and co-creator of the television series American Dad!

  6. MacFarlane began to establish himself as an actor, voice actor, animator, writer, producer, director, comedian, and singer throughout his career. MacFarlane has also written, directed and starred in Ted (2012) and its sequel Ted 2 (2015), and A Million Ways to Die in the West (2014).

  7. 11 mai 2024 · Seth MacFarlane (born October 26, 1973, Kent, Connecticut, U.S.) is an American writer, animator, actor, and producer who was perhaps best known for creating the television series Family Guy (1999–2003, 2005– ), American Dad (2005– ), The Cleveland Show (2009–13), and The Orville (2017– ).
